Common use

Medex (Coumadin) is an anticoagulant (blood thinner). Medex reduces the formation of blood clots. Medex is used to treat or prevent blood clots in veins or arteries, which can reduce the risk of stroke, heart attack, or other serious conditions.

Precautions

Medex can make it easier for you to bleed. Seek emergency help if you have any bleeding that will not stop.
You may need to stop taking Medex 5 to 7 days before having any surgery, dental work, or a medical procedure. Call your doctor for instructions.
To make sure this medicine is safe for you, tell your doctor if you have ever had: diabetes; congestive heart failure; liver disease, kidney disease (or if you are on dialysis); a hereditary clotting deficiency; or low blood platelets after receiving heparin.

Contraindications

You should not take Medex if you are allergic to warfarin, or if: you have malignant hypertension, which is a specific type of very high blood pressure that comes on suddenly and quickly; you recently had or will have surgery on your brain, spine, or eye; you undergo a spinal tap or spinal anesthesia (epidural); or if you think you will not be able to take Medex on time every day, talk to your prescriber about other treatment options.
You also should not take Medex if you are are prone to bleeding because of a medical condition, such as: a blood cell disorder (such as low red blood cells or low platelets); ulcers or bleeding in your stomach, intestines, lungs, or urinary tract; an aneurysm or bleeding in the brain; or an infection of the lining of your heart.
Do not take Medex if you are pregnant, unless your doctor tells you to.

Possible side effect

Get emergency medical help if you have signs of an allergic reaction to Medex: hives; difficult breathing; swelling of your face, lips, tongue, or throat.
Medex increases your risk of bleeding, which can be severe or life-threatening. Call your doctor at once if you have any signs of bleeding such as: sudden headache, feeling very weak or dizzy; swelling, pain, unusual bruising; bleeding gums, nosebleeds; bleeding from wounds or needle injections that will not stop; heavy menstrual periods or abnormal vaginal bleeding; blood in your urine, bloody or tarry stools; or coughing up blood or vomit that looks like coffee grounds.
Clots formed by Medex may block normal blood flow, which could lead to tissue death or amputation of the affected body part. Get medical help at once if you have: pain, swelling, hot or cold feeling, skin changes, or discoloration anywhere on your body; or sudden and severe leg or foot pain, foot ulcer, purple toes or fingers.
Bleeding is the most common side effect of Medex (Coumadin).

Drug interaction

Many drugs (including some over-the-counter medicines and herbal products) can affect your INR and may increase the risk of bleeding if you take them with Medex (Coumadin). It is very important to ask your doctor and pharmacist before you start or stop using any other medicine, especially: other medicines to prevent blood clots; an antibiotic or antifungal medicine; supplements that contain vitamin K; or herbal (botanical) products - coenzyme Q10, cranberry, echinacea, garlic, ginkgo biloba, ginseng, goldenseal, or St. John's wort.

Missed dose

Take the missed dose as soon as you remember. Skip the missed dose if it is almost time for your next scheduled dose. Do not take extra medicine to make up the missed dose.

Overdose

Seek emergency medical attention. An overdose can cause excessive bleeding.

Storage

Store at room temperature away from heat, moisture, and light. Keep away from children and pets.
